How much electricity does a network server rack consume

A typical server rack consumes between 7 kW and 15 kW, with high-density or HPC/AI racks reaching up to 30 kW or more.Typical Power UsageStandard racks in modern data centers generally draw 7–15 kW of electricity depending on the number and type of servers, storage devices, and network equipment installed .High-density racks, often used for AI, machine learning, or high-performance computing (HPC), can consume 15–30 kW or more .Older or less efficient servers may draw more power, while modern energy-efficient servers with optimized CPUs, SSDs, and power supplies can reduce consumption .Factors Affecting ConsumptionServer Hardware: Blade servers and high-performance CPUs increase power draw compared to standard rack-mounted servers .Server Utilization: Power usage rises with CPU, memory, and storage load; idle servers still consume baseline power .Rack Density: More devices per rack increase total consumption; high-density racks maximize space but require more power .Redundancy and Backup: UPS systems, redundant power supplies, and failover equipment add to total energy use .Cooling Requirements: Air conditioning, CRAC units, or liquid cooling can double the effective power needed due to the Power Usage Effectiveness (PUE) of the data center . Typical PUE values range from 1.2–1.8, with modern efficient facilities closer to 1.2–1.4 .Calculating Energy UseTo estimate electricity consumption over time:Multiply the average power draw (kW) by the hours of operation to get kWh. For example, a 10 kW rack running 24/7 consumes 240 kWh per day.Adjust for PUE to account for cooling and overhead. For a PUE of 1.5, the same rack would effectively consume 360 kWh per day .Multiply by your local electricity rate to estimate costs.SummaryServer rack electricity consumption varies widely based on hardware, utilization, density, redundancy, and cooling. Standard racks typically use 7–15 kW, while high-density or HPC racks can exceed 30 kW. Accurate planning requires considering both IT load and facility overhead, including cooling and PUE, to ensure efficient and cost-effective operation .
